Product Description:
D-threo Sphinganine (d18:0) is primarily used in research related to sphingolipid metabolism and cell signaling pathways. It serves as a key intermediate in the biosynthesis of more complex sphingolipids, which are essential components of cell membranes and play critical roles in cellular processes such as apoptosis, proliferation, and differentiation.
In biochemical studies, it is utilized to investigate the enzymatic steps involved in sphingolipid synthesis, particularly the activity of serine palmitoyltransferase and ceramide synthase. It is also employed in studies exploring the role of sphingolipids in diseases like cancer, neurodegenerative disorders, and metabolic syndromes.
Additionally, D-threo Sphinganine (d18:0) is used as a standard in analytical techniques such as mass spectrometry and chromatography to quantify and identify sphingolipids in biological samples. Its application extends to the development of therapeutic strategies targeting sphingolipid pathways for disease treatment.
